A pitbull type dog who was discovered discarded in an Aldi bag for life in a Peterborough street has actually been put to sleep after it was found he was a prohibited type.

Stanley was hours from death when he was discovered deserted in a park in Vermont Grove, Peterborough in September. Stanley was referred to as being simply skin and bones, with veterinarians and RSPCA employees frightened by his condition, and he required life conserving treatment to endure.

However regretfully, almost 2 months on, Stanley has actually needed to be put to sleep by the RSPCA after it was found he was a pitbull terrier type dog– a prohibited type, which indicated lawfully he might not be re-homed.

Today a representative for the RSPCA stated personnel at the charity had actually been left ravaged by the news– and explained the legislation that resulted in his death as ‘out-of-date and inefficient.’

” We would have enjoyed absolutely nothing more than to have actually discovered him the caring house he should have”

The representative stated: “We are all definitely ravaged that due to the fact that Stanley has actually been recognized as a forbidden kind of dog – under Area 1 of the Dangerous Dogs Act – we were lawfully not able to rehome him.

” This choice is entirely out of our hands; and suggests he has actually successfully been sentenced to death by legislation which our company believe to be obsoleted and inefficient.

” The RSPCA has actually been doing whatever lawfully possible and readily available to us to assist Stanley. Offered what he has actually been through, he, thus numerous canines, should have a 2nd opportunity. We have actually checked out a variety of choices which we hoped would permit Stanley to be lawfully kept however none have actually been possible and due to the fact that of this terrible and inefficient law he needed to be put to sleep.

” This is an enormously distressing circumstance for all associated with the care of Stanley and we would have enjoyed absolutely nothing more than to have actually discovered him the caring house he should have however, sadly, the law does not enable us to do this. This is why the RSPCA opposes type particular legislation (BSL) and want to see it reversed.

” Nobody might stop working to have actually been moved by those horrible images of a starving puppy delegated pass away in a shopping bag. He sustained a lot – and he’s been pulled down to start with by his owners and second of all by a law which is entirely unreasonable and is stopping working to secure the general public. The law requires to alter so more canines – like Stanley – aren’t unnecessarily put to sleep due to the fact that of how they look.

” Anybody who feels sad like us about this bad puppy’s story, we would advise them to support our project to end BSL by calling their MP through our project’s page.”

4 kinds of canines are forbidden from being owned or kept in the UK. These consist of pit bull terriers, Fila Brasilieros, Dogo Argentinos and Japanese Tosas.

After Stanley was discovered in the park on September 6, there was an appeal for details to discover who was accountable. Nevertheless the perpetrator has actually never ever been discovered.
